Overview

Selden Neck State Park, situated in Connecticut, USA, offers a unique outdoor experience for campers who enjoy seclusion and a rustic, primitive camping atmosphere. Being an island in the Connecticut River, it is accessible only by water, which adds an adventurous element to the camping trip.

Location

Selden Neck State Park is located in the middle of the Connecticut River, between the towns of Lyme and Chester. The island is part of the Lower Connecticut River Valley, which is designated as an "Important Birding Area" by Audubon Connecticut.

Getting There

Since Selden Neck is an island, the only way to reach it is by boat. Kayakers, canoers, and those with small power boats often use this park for camping trips.

Campsites

The park features four primitive campsites suitable for small groups. These sites come with few amenities – typically just a fire ring and a flat area to pitch tents. Because these sites are primitive, they do not have running water or restroom facilities, so campers must come prepared to be self-sufficient and pack out all trash.

Reservations and Fees

Advance reservations may be required to secure a spot, so checking with the Connecticut Department of Energy and Environmental Protection (DEEP) is crucial. They manage the state parks and can provide information on fees and obtaining the necessary permits.

Activities

  • Boating and Kayaking: Given the location, water activities are a primary attraction.
  • Fishing: The Connecticut River is a fishing destination for various species, including bass and pike.
  • Hiking: Although limited due to the size of the island, hiking trails are available.
  • Wildlife Viewing: With the designation as an Important Birding Area, bird watching is particularly rewarding.

Leave No Trace

It is important for campers to follow Leave No Trace principles. This includes proper disposal of waste, respecting wildlife, and preserving the natural environment by avoiding the disturbance of natural features and vegetation.

Safety Concerns

  • Water Safety: Life jackets should be used on the water at all times.
  • Wildlife: Be aware of wildlife, including bears and snakes, and take precautions to avoid conflicts.
  • Navigation: Navigating the Connecticut River, particularly for inexperienced boaters, can be challenging. Check weather and water conditions before departure.
